 As of September 2008, minimum CPC values stopped playing a role in
determining whether your ad is active or inactive for search. This
post on the AdWords blog covers some of those changes:

  http://adwords.blogspot.com/2008/09/quality-score-improvements-to-go-live.html

 AdWords API v13's first page bid estimates are exposed via the
firstPageCpc attribute of the Keyword object. We're not exposing
minCpc anymore as the value lacks its previous significance.
